Mandela family
Dynasty of South African politicians and traditional aristocrats
The Mandela family is a Xhosa royal family in South Africa.

Its most prominent member was Nelson Mandela, who served as President of South Africa from 1994 to 1999.
History
The Mandelas are direct descendants of the AmaHala clan, the ruling dynasty of the Kingdom of AbaThembu,[1] as a result, their leader has traditionally had a hereditary claim to both membership of the Thembu king's privy council and the chieftaincy of the town of Mvezo that is subject to his authority.
